Until they fix the tactics menu (at least for the PC) there really is no way to kill a dragon on Nightmare at the appropriate level unless you employ some level of cheese (outside range fighting, KE invulnerability).

 

While trying to legit take down a dragon I have run into the following issues:

 

1.  Characters simply do not follow commands issued to them in the tactics menu (especially if you switch viewpoints to see what is going on).

2.  Hold position is non functional causing my players to run directly into the dragons aoe.

3.  Characters warp to other characters randomly  (especially annoying when it is the tank.

 

Right now dragon fights are visually stunning but an annoying buggy mess.

The DPS value is missleading. Check the weapon damage value to compare weapons. The best staff (crafted) is around 72 weapon damage. My mages and Sera are ripping everything apart. This started around Lvl15+ and gets better and better. Most dragon fights are Lvl15+, so they go down fast and clean. Each dragon except the first one from Hinterlands was down in 2 minutes or less on nightmare with controlled tank and party on AI.
